Summary

The investigators will investigate the efficacy of using CR and PS implants in TKA. The investigators will conduct TKA with different implants simultaneously on one patient to compare the post-operation efficacy of both implants.

Detailed description

A randomized, single-center, single group study comparing the efficacy and safety of using CR and PS implants in TKA. The investigators will conduct TKA with different implants simultaneously on one patient to compare the post-operation efficacy of both implants. Subjects will be monitored through postoperative follow-up to understand the bilateral knee condition.

Interventions

TypeNameDescription
DEVICECruciate-retaining (CR) prosthesesOne leg is conducted TKA with Cruciate-retaining (CR) prostheses.
DEVICEPosterior-stabilized (PS) prosthesesOne leg is conducted TKA with Posterior-stabilized (PS) prostheses.
